Mca Program
The term MCA is an abbreviation of Master of Computer Applications that is a three year program in which it comprises of six semesters. This is a professional master's degree program in India that is designed to meet the growing demand of qualified professionals in the IT industry. In this program, admission can be taken after obtaining a Bachelor's degree. This program provides a sound theoretical background and excellent practical exposure to the students in these areas. It covers many aspects of algorithm design and optimization, programming, computational theory, network and database management, mathematics, probability, accounting, finance, statistics, mobile technologies etc.
After doing MCA program from the reputed institute, an individual can go in various fields. These fields are described as under:-
1) Hardware and networking: - Hardware and networking field contains the physical elements of the computer system. This field of computing usually deals with the manufacturing, designing and maintenance of computers. It also assembles the manufactured components of the computers, installation and integration of the computer systems through networks.
2) Software engineering and development:- Software engineering and development includes the set of instructions that is called programs for working and performing the specified tasks. These programs may come in the form of packages that are specially designed for specific requirements.
Software testing and Quality maintenance:- In the last few years, the dimension of software development has emerged as separate sector i.e. software testing of the developed programs and ensuring then quality in the team technical aspect and operational as well.
3) Services and application support:- Services and application support includes system integration and applications management, networking and database management, installation and maintenance of software applications and much more.
4) Research and development: - Research and development involves the designing of chips and circuits, integration of peripherals and computer architecture. This field also has the improvement and upgrading of the existing systems, software and applications.
As a result, we can say that MCA program opens a lot of job opportunities for the students. After studying, an individual can begin his career as a junior programmer as well as can grow at the very fast pace to become systems analysts and project leaders.

What On Earth Is a Proforma Income Statement And Does It Really Help Make Good Real Estate Investment Decisions?
The proforma income statement (or proforma) is regarded as a real estate investments report that investors and analysts normally use when it comes to predicting the revenues a rental real estate asset might produce for a prospective owner over time. Here's the idea.
As a result of projecting out across a certain number of years the income that the investment property could very well create, investors and analysts have the ability to undertake a profitability evaluation that will make it easier for them to measure the future over-all performance of a property. Thus lending support to their investing decision-making process.
There are no constraints over the amount of years that you would like the proforma income statement to present. I have spotted proformas (for instance) that provide statements which range from ten to twenty years; a few software companies in fact boast that their application delivers thirty-year estimates. In spite of this, I honestly think that these kind of longer span forecasts can turn out to be too unreliable to generally be granted very much weight. You will discover just too many factors which can affect any sort of cash flow estimate (even more so for that many years). So if you are using a real estate investment analysis software solution that generates a ten-year proforma income statement to conduct your rental property evaluations you can regard that sufficient.
Similarly, a proforma is not limited to the assortment of fiscal details it unveils. A first-rate statement will need to (at the very minimum) project annual (end of the year) results for income flows, rates of return, and the proceeds that are the result of a sale (known as reversion). However the better proformas additionally include the aspects of tax shelter; thereby enabling real estate analysts to also consider the the "after-tax" returns generated by the property. This is important. The income tax liability an investor encounters during ownership of the property plays a crucial role on whether or not the property is a profitable investment opportunity. Therefore it is smart to use a proforma that includes full consideration for income taxes.
Okay, but aside from all of that, there are two overriding issues crucial for you to consider.
1) That regardless what features and data you prefer, the proforma must accommodate your business objectives and show you the data you require to make a real estate investment decision.
2) That the forecasts you intend to make are relying on solid data. No proforma income statement is good for anything other than lining the birdcage if the data is faulty. When making your projections, for example, when you believe that rental cash flow can reasonably appreciate two percent a year than drive back the urge to bloat that number to three or four percent simply because you pray so. You may even look at staggering the amount of growth merely to be safe. Maybe three percent appreciation in year two, two percent in year three, and zero percent for the remaining years.
How do you go about obtaining a proforma income statement? Naturally, you can create your own with an Excel spreadsheet and some surplus time. In fact, a whole lot of surplus time. On the other hand you can consider just investing in a good real estate software program that will create the statement for you. Regardless, whether you make it yourself or invest in software, you definitely don't want to be without a proforma the next time you get around to investing in investment real estate.

An Online Resume Is A Very Good Idea
The modern business world reaps so many different benefits from the Internet. Employers and job seekers alike have found that all aspects of communication are greatly enhanced by the advent of the world wide web. One of the most important ways that our modern approaches benefit both those who are looking for employees and those who are looking for work can be found in the idea of an online resume.
From the job seeker's perspective, this is an incredible development. Electronic documents can be copied and shared with absolutely no difficult and with no fear of a loss in quality. More importantly, they can be posted on web sites (your own or that of an aggregating service) where they will stay unaltered and always accessible for an impressively long time.
More to the point, if you have your curriculum vitae posted on the Internet you can be reasonably sure that anyone who is looking at it is seeing the most up to date and current version. Each time you need to make a change or an addition to the document, you can update the posted version instead of having to remember where you sent paper copies.
Many employers keep copies of CVs and job applications on file if they think there might be a use later on. Sometimes a company will only hire one of two people to test out a new department or work protocol, and once this trial period is over they may be looking to greatly expand their number of workers. An electronic CV will always be accessible to the prospective employer.
There are also several sites which act as intermediaries between the job seeker and the person who is looking to hire someone. From an employer's point of view, the ability to search a vast database of information according to whatever relevant keywords they choose can be an incredible time saver. The lack of physical paperwork also makes the prospect of sifting through dozens of applications somehow less daunting.
Indeed, someone who is looking for a new staff member and who is searching through a job hunting database that caters to those who are looking for work will be able to conduct their research from almost anywhere and at almost any time. As long as there is an Internet connection, they can even peruse the CVs of prospective employees in a coffee shop if they so desire.
When things are convenient for both the job seeker and the employer, the job opening will likely be filled quickly. This can be a very important benefit for both parties.
Consider using an online resume to help you increase your job opportunities. It is considerably more convenient for all concerned, and it enables you to have your information accessible at any time by anyone in the world. If you are an employer, make sure to investigate the various online services which house these CVs in a way that allows searching. The Internet is perfect for interpersonal communication, and this is just another way to demonstrate that fact.
